myChart.on('click', function (params) {
if (params.componentType === 'series' && params.seriesType === 'line') {
var dataIndex = params.dataIndex;
if(request!=null){
var url = "./data/cnn4/aapd/metrics_epoch_" + dataIndex + ".json";/*json文件url,本地的就写本地的位置,如果是服务器的就写服务器的路径*/
request.open("GET", url,true);/*设置请求方法与路径*/
// request.setRequestHeader('Content-Type','application/json');
//request.overrideMimeType("application/json");
request.onreadystatechange = function () {/*XHR对象获取到返回信息后执行*/
if(request.readyState == 4){
if (request.status == 200) {/*返回状态为200,即为数据获取成功*/
var json = JSON.parse(request.responseText);
//后面开始读数据操作
https://blog.csdn.net/qq649954944/article/details/80241556,上面链接应该可以解答你的疑惑